Damn teenagers! How to find common ground with an adult child
Child and adolescent psychologist Nikita Karpov knows everything about growing up. For over 15 years, he has been helping teenagers and parents find common ground and solve their problems. In an easy-going manner, with a touch of humor, Nikita Karpov...
shares real cases, professional techniques, and methods that will save your nerves, establish strong trusting relationships, and help raise an independent person. He will open your eyes to the fact that puberty is actually a very interesting period, from which both parents and teenagers can derive pleasure. “The teenage years always guarantee parents several years of very entertaining life. With an emotional rollercoaster, unexplored anxieties, and a lot of conflicts over any issue. No matter how hard we try to communicate with these amazing beings, we often find ourselves hitting our noses against a closed door. Well, let's figure out how to survive this wonderful age without killing your teenager and, preferably, without spending all the family savings on novopassit and wine.” FROM THIS BOOK YOU WILL LEARN: – who these teenagers are and what actually worries them; – how to keep your nerves intact and not lash out at your child; – what professionals suggest doing to build positive relationships and see results; – what needs to be done for your child to fully trust you; – how to learn to trust your teenager and let go of situations that do not require control.
